Pumps: Necessary for Fluid Activity
In the oil extraction procedure, the function of pumps is substantial, promoting the activity of liquids throughout different phases of manufacturing. Pumps are important for delivering petroleum, water, and other liquids from underground reservoirs to the surface area and after that through pipes to refineries. They are available in different types, consisting of centrifugal, positive variation, and completely submersible pumps, each serving certain objectives based upon the liquid attributes and operational needs. Centrifugal pumps are frequently utilized for their effectiveness in high-flow applications, while favorable variation pumps excel in handling thick fluids. The option of pump impacts overall performance, operational safety, and maintenance prices. Proper option and upkeep of pumps are crucial for enhancing production and decreasing downtime in oil area operations.

Kinds of Valves
Important parts in oil field procedures, valves play an important function in controlling the flow and pressure of liquids within pipelines and equipment. Various sorts of shutoffs are made use of to satisfy the diverse requirements of oil and gas manufacturing. Typical kinds consist of entrance shutoffs, which give a straight-line circulation and very little stress decrease; world valves, known for their strangling capabilities; and round shutoffs, identified for their fast on/off control. Furthermore, check shutoffs prevent heartburn, while butterfly shutoffs supply a lightweight option for controling circulation. Each shutoff kind is designed with specific products and arrangements to withstand the severe problems often located in oil fields, making certain reliability and performance in operations. Understanding these types is important for efficient system administration.

Compressors: Enhancing Gas Transport
Compressors play a critical function in the effective transportation of gas, making sure that it relocates smoothly via pipelines over fars away. These tools increase the stress of gas, enabling it to get rid of rubbing and altitude changes within the pipeline system. Furthermore, compressors help with the balancing of supply and demand, suiting variations in intake and production rates. Various kinds of compressors are used in the sector, consisting of centrifugal, reciprocating, and rotating screw compressors, each offering unique advantages based upon the operational needs. Regular upkeep of these compressors is vital to make the most of efficiency and minimize downtime, eventually adding to a trustworthy gas transportation network. Their vital function emphasizes the value of compressors in the overall oil and gas framework.
